Decreasing thick plants is a vital aspect of landscape management, assisting to restore order, enhance visual app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can limit air flow, lower sunshine penetration, and develop opportunities for pests and illness. Pruning and thinning are the main techniques for handling dense or rowdy plant life, permitting plants to prosper while keeping a regulated appearance. The procedure includes sel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, always thinking about the natural development practice of each types. Timing is essential; some plants respond best to pruning during dormancy, while flowering varieties may need post-bloom cutting to preserve blossoms. Proper strategy makes sure cuts are clean and positioned to motivate healthy new growth. In addition to boosting plant health, reducing overgrowth enhances accessibility and visibility in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outside home end up being more secure and more inviting. Long-term upkeep strategies prevent future overgrowth, ensuring a well balanced and unified landscape.
